Narrative:
The nosegear of the Piper PA-23-250 Aztec F collapsed during landing at Ninoy Aquino Airport - RPLL. The runway was closed for an hour and caused many delays. The Aztec suffered substantial damages.

The pilot and copilot of the aircraft escaped uninjured.
